Output 871b66b4d053a723d3ab74b4aa3edcb2c0f5e1663a03dfbf61367ee07d00965d:1

value
8267828
script pubkey
OP_0 OP_PUSHBYTES_20 dd253a1c00f4145b68b418b90fb31448abb96511
address
bc1qm5jn58qq7s29k695rzuslvc5fz4mjeg3kpsy0p
transaction
871b66b4d053a723d3ab74b4aa3edcb2c0f5e1663a03dfbf61367ee07d00965d
confirmations
40883
spent
true